Subject: Plowline Gateway sandbox access

Hi folks,

Good news — the Plowline telemetry gateway sandbox is live, so your plugins can start pulling tractor and combine feeds today. Payloads match the spec we shared, with one extra field for implement hours. Rate limits are relaxed in sandbox, so hammer away. Authenticate your plugin's requests with the sandbox bearer token below.

session JWT of yawep-yawep = eyJhbGciOiJIUzI1NiIsInR5cCI6IkpXVCJ9.eyJzdWIiOiI3pWF3_In0.aXYsHiog

Handing off Lanternfish API on-call. Open item: cursor pagination on /v2/orders drops records when clients sort by updated_at during heavy writes. Workaround in place (snapshot tokens), proper fix tracked for next sprint. Rate limits unchanged. Nothing else burning. If the partner integrators at Bramblewick ping again about duplicate pages, loop in their lead here.

escalation mailbox, bafog-fafog: ulador@paliqlabs.internal

## Step 4: Enable the Metrelle aggregation sidecar

Before promoting traffic, deploy the Metrelle sidecar alongside each pod in the Harkwell cluster. It intercepts StatsD emissions from the legacy Quillon daemon and rolls them into one-minute windows, so ensure the old flush interval is disabled first, otherwise counts will double. Future maintainers: the scrape port must match what the Veldane gateway expects, or metrics silently drop. The values below reflect the staging rollout and should be copied verbatim into production.

config for yajep-tafof:
[rusath]
team = julmir
access_code = ac_fe37fd
host = rusath.novactech.test
port = 8000
owner = pelmir.weneth
peer = oliwyn.olvarqdyn.internal

**Ticket: Sign-off needed — Fieldnote offline mode**

Hey, offline mode for Fieldnote is ready to ship in 4.2. Surveys save locally, queue up, and sync once you're back in range. We soak-tested it on a week of no-signal runs out near the Harrow Flats pilot and nothing got lost. Just needs the usual release sign-off before we cut the build. Sign-off belongs to the person below.

named custodian: Brivan Eliath Quenox Frador